How It Works¶
This example shows three progressive configurations:
1. Basic Agent (No Tools)¶
Just foundation + provider = minimal agent with no tools.
Result: Agent can answer questions but cannot execute tools.
2. Agent with Tools¶
tools_config = Bundle(
name="tools-config",
tools=[
{"module": "tool-filesystem", "source": "git+https://..."},
{"module": "tool-bash", "source": "git+https://..."}
]
)
composed = foundation.compose(provider).compose(tools_config)
Composition chain: foundation → provider → tools
Result: Agent can now read/write files and execute bash commands.

3. Streaming Agent¶
streaming_config = Bundle(
name="streaming-config",
session={
"orchestrator": {
"module": "loop-streaming", # Streaming orchestrator!
"source": "git+https://..."
}
},
hooks=[
{
"module": "hooks-streaming-ui", # Hook to display streaming output
"source": "git+https://..."
}
]
)
composed = foundation.compose(provider).compose(streaming_config)
Composition chain: foundation → provider → streaming
Result: Responses stream in real-time as the model generates them.

Key Concepts¶
Composition Over Configuration¶
# Want different behavior? Compose different modules!
basic = foundation.compose(provider)
with_tools = foundation.compose(provider).compose(tools_config)
streaming = foundation.compose(provider).compose(streaming_config)
No flags to toggle, no YAML configuration files - just compose the capabilities you need.
Module Sources¶
Modules can come from:
- Git URLs:
git+https://github.com/org/repo@main - Local paths:
./modules/my-module - Git subdirectories:
git+https://github.com/org/repo@main#subdirectory=modules/foo
Session Configuration¶
The session section controls:
- Orchestrator: How the agent loop runs (
loop-basic,loop-streaming) - Context: How conversation history is managed
Adding Capabilities¶
Each capability type has its own section:
providers: LLM backendstools: Agent capabilitieshooks: Lifecycle hooks for UI, logging, etc.
